Pink t-shirts will fill the stands Jan. 25 for the VS/CPU boys basketball game.

Two black and gold teams will put on pink to help fight breast cancer.

When the Vinton-Shellsburg boys basketball team hosts Center Point-Urbana on Friday, Jan. 25, the players will wear pink shirts made especially for that night. Those shirts will be auctioned via silent auction at half-time to raise funds for the mammorgraphy services at Virginia Gay Hospital. T-shirts for both VS and CPU fans also are now available for purchase. See links to order forms below.

Pink night has become a tradition in recent years for both boys and girls basketball teams.
